When someone says they are “platform agnostic,” it typically means they are impartial or neutral toward choosing between different technology platforms. In a business context, this can mean that a company or individual doesn’t favor one operating system, software, hardware, or technology over another. Instead, they focus on functionality and performance, choosing the best tools or platforms based on the specific needs of a project or objective, rather than being limited by allegiance to any particular technology. This approach enables flexibility and adaptability in solving technological challenges.

While both a Data Warehouse and a Customer Data Platform involve data consolidation, the scope, functionality, and end-use of these systems differ substantially, with CDPs being more focused on marketing needs and customer-centric insights, and data warehouses serving broader analytical needs across an organization.
